Understanding Yield in Crypto
Before exploring specific strategies, it's crucial to grasp the concept of yield in the context of cryptocurrency. Yield refers to the return on investment (ROI) generated from holding and utilizing crypto assets. This can come in various forms, including interest from lending, dividends from staking, and passive income from dec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ols. Unlike traditional investments, crypto yields can be more volatile but also offer higher potential returns due to the decentralized and innovative nature of the space.

3. Yield Farming
Yield farming is a more aggressive approach that invol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or participating in liquidity pools to earn rewards. These rewards can be in the form of native tokens, staking rewards, or other crypto assets. The key to successful yield farming is identifying high-yield opportunities and managing risk effectively.
Platforms like Uniswap, SushiSwap, and Curve offer various yield farming opportunities. For instance, providing liquidity to a Curve pool for stablecoins can yield APYs (Annual Percentage Yield) of 5% to 15%, depending on the specific pair and market conditions. To maximize returns, investors should monitor multiple protocols and adjust their strategies based on changing market dynamics and reward structures.
